Overview
The Quality Regulatory & Performance Improvement (PI) Specialist performs a variety of functions under the Quality Department scope of work with primary focus on playing a key role in monitoring regulatory standards, preparing for accreditation surveys, driving performance improvement initiatives and contributing to the provision of high-quality patient care. The Regulatory & PI specialist would serve as a resource to hospital and medical staff departments to ensure the compliance with regulatory agency standards. Play an active role in planning and implementation of compliance activities for accreditation and/or regulatory agencies requirements, including Joint Commission and CMS. This position would collect, analyze, and present data related to ongoing regulatory compliance efforts.

Qualifications
- Registered Nurse with current licensure for the state of Alabama
- Minimum of three years’ experience in an acute care facility.
- Clinical background that would facilitate assessment of patient care data for coordination of quality projects.
- Ability to work independently, and manage multiple projects, with strong prioritizing skills
- Familiarity with Joint Commission and CMS standards and terminology
- Basic knowledge of computers and office productivity software.
- Basic knowledge of data analysis.
